US states named after an element?

Element named after a US state: Californium. This is the only element named after a US state. But, there is also Americium. Americium is named after America.

What state has the same name as a famous US president whose term was during the Civil War?

No state is named after a Civil War era president. The only state named for a president is Washington State, named for our first president, George Washington.
